Unwind and connect with your community at the Multigenerational Coloring Club, hosted by the Western Allegheny Community Library. This inclusive event invites people of all ages to gather, share creative space, and enjoy the meditative practice of coloring. Whether you are a seasoned artist or just looking for a peaceful morning activity, this club provides a welcoming environment for everyone. Come enjoy some quiet time and artistic expression in the heart of Oakdale.
